WebTo have pages read aloud to you, turn on your Chromebook’s built-in screen reader: At the bottom right, select the time. Or press Alt + Shift + s. Select Settings Accessibility. Under "Text-to-Speech," turn on ChromeVox. Tip: When you press Ctrl + Alt + z, you can turn ChromeVox on or off from any page. Learn how to use the built-in screen ... WebFeb 19, 2024 · Open your Word document and head to the Review tab. Select Read Aloud in the Speech section of the ribbon. When the small control bar appears, you can manage the playback and adjust a couple of settings. Use the Play/Pause button to stop and resume.
